Project Description | GEF-CBIT will support Costa Rica in establishing an overarching structure across all sectors that will ensure high quality in its transparency instruments; and create the capacities to transcend in the usage of MRV for policy design inputs. CBIT’s most important contribution will occur through the creation of capacities at an inter-sectoral level. This cross-sectorial work is fundamental to Costa Rica due to the economy-wide nature of its’ NDC target, which seeks to drive deep, transformational de-carbonization which can only be achieved incorporating multi/inter-sectoral approaches. |
